The system now supports real-time log streaming from workers to the hub via Redis Pub/Sub and PostgreSQL persistence:
- ✅ Push-based delivery - No polling overhead
- ✅ Persistent storage - Jobs survive restarts
- ✅ Sub-100ms latency - Real-time UI updates
- ✅ Automatic fallback - Works with or without Redis
# 1. Start Redis
docker-compose up -d redis
# 2. Install dependencies
make setup
# 3. Initialize database tables
make init-streaming
# 4. Configure environment (.env)
REDIS_URL=redis://localhost:6379
ENABLE_LOG_STREAMING=true📖 See STREAMING_MIGRATION_GUIDE.md for detailed setup instructions.
The Chainlit agent expects an MCP server that exposes its tools over HTTP:
- Default endpoint:
http://localhost:1337/mcp - Configure with the
MCP_SERVER_URLenvironment variable - Optional timeout override:
MCP_HTTP_TIMEOUT(seconds)
